Pablo Ayala is a 30-year-old football player who plays as a midfielder for Rubio Nu, born on 30 de junio de 1995. Follow Pablo Ayala on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2026 Division Profesional season, Pablo Ayala has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 16 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 5.89.

Pablo Ayala's career has also included time at Club Sportivo Carapeguá, General Caballero JLM, Sportivo Trinidense, Guairena, Sol de America, 12 de Octubre, and Club River Plate.

Throughout their career, Pablo Ayala has won 1 title: Division Intermedia (2018) with Club River Plate.
